Joanna L. Darvish attended Southern Nazarene University in Bethany, Oklahoma, where she received a Bachelor or Arts degree in Mass Communication/Journalism and a Master of Arts degree in Speech Communication. In 1991, she was a graduate assistant in the Speech Department at Southern Nazarene University, teaching college-level public speaking and interpersonal communication courses.
Ms. Darvish attended California Western School of Law where she was a member/writer of the California Western Law Review and International Law Journal. She was also awarded the Academic Achievement Award for her accomplishments in Real Property Finance. While in law school, Ms. Darvish clerked in the General Counsel office of the United Service Automobile Association (USAA) specializing in ERISA issues. In the Spring of 2001, Ms. Darvish served as a certified legal intern for the San Diego City Attorney's Office, Domestic Violence Unit. Ms. Darvish received her Juris Doctorate in 2001, having been named to the Dean's List.
Ms. Darvish is a member of the California State Bar. Ms. Darvish joined Kring & Chung in 2001 and handles fraud, contract, and construction defect litigation matters for education and business clients.
